#317637 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#317637 is composed of 19.2% red, 46.3% green and 21.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.4% yellow and 53.7% black. It has a hue angle of 125.2 degrees, a saturation of 41.3% and a lightness of 32.7%. #317637 color hex could be obtained by blending #62ec6e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#317637 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#317637 has RGB values of R:49, G:118, B:55 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0, Y:0.53, K:0.54. Its decimal value is 3241527.

Shades and Tints of #317637
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030703 is the darkest color, while #f8f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#317637
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515652 is the less saturated color, while #04a312 is the most saturated one.
